UndKind
Ученик
(210)
15 лет назад
Для начала обратите внимание на свой процессор, если он 2х ядерный-тогда вам необходима 64 разрядная Windows.Но, т. к. раньше пользовался популярностью 1ядерный проц, то и винда была 32 разрядная. Весь софт писали для нее. С появлением 2х, 3х и т. д. процессоров-изменилась винда (точнее большинство стали ставить 64раз.). Софт поспевать не успевает, поэтому если софт новый-то он поддерживает 64 разряд. винду и устанавливается в program files,если же он старый (значит создан для 1 ядерного процессора и 32 разрядной винды) и будет уст. в program files х86.(и его производительность будет как на 1ядерном процессоре.
BarbosМастер (1026)
15 лет назад
так и думал, и именно те подробности что я хотел узнать.проц 4 ядерный, но только ещё не понимаю почему приписка идёт именно 86, а не 32. Т.е. почему разработчики придумали именно 86 назвать.
venturaУченик (186)
8 лет назад
Полнейшая ересь. Процессор здесь совершенно не при чём (и уж тем более, количество его ядер).
Точнее, проц должен поддерживать 64-разрядную архитектуру, но это есть во всех современных (и не очень) процессорах.
Основное отличие в том, что 32-разрядная система не может использовать больше 4 Гб (на практике - около 3 Гб, зависит от железа) оперативной памяти. А также выделять больше 2Гб памяти одному приложению. Для снятия этого ограничения используют 64-разрядные ОС.
Другими словами, если у вас больше 3Гб ОЗУ - ставьте х64. Иначе в системе будут доступны лишь 3-4 Гб.